Output 53c0facbb5890736b7f5de44bda0ccc6a0f18fc7233481dec8b5db5b1074613e:1

value
11612
script pubkey
OP_0 OP_PUSHBYTES_20 5ae3f716519e26c592ac709e8b83042dff970858
address
bc1qtt3lw9j3ncnvty4vwz0ghqcy9hlewzzcmh5fpq
transaction
53c0facbb5890736b7f5de44bda0ccc6a0f18fc7233481dec8b5db5b1074613e
confirmations
403560
spent
true